#b00095 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b00095 is composed of 69% red, 0%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 15.3%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 309.2 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 34.5%. #b00095 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ff00ff with #61002b. Closest websafe color is: #990099.

Shades and Tints of #b00095

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#130010 is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#b00095

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5f515d is the less saturated color, while #b00095 is the most saturated one.
